About Nudgee Beach Dog Park
Nudgee Beach Dog Park offers a dedicated space for off-leash exercise along the coastline of Nudgee Beach. The area features a mix of sandy stretches and tidal flats, allowing dogs to swim and interact with the natural environment during low tide. The park is equipped with essential amenities including waste disposal bins, fresh water stations, and outdoor showers to rinse off sand and salt after a visit. It serves as a popular destination for residents in the northern suburbs of Brisbane looking for an outdoor setting that accommodates pets.
The location is situated near the Boondall Wetlands, providing a quiet atmosphere away from busy urban centres. Visitors can access the beach via well-maintained paths that lead from the car park to the water's edge. While the area is primarily for canine recreation, it also offers picnic tables and shaded spots for owners to use. The park remains a key recreational asset for the 4014 postcode, offering direct access to the Moreton Bay marine environment for daily exercise and socialisation.
